Definitions
- noun. See Slav.
- noun. A person who is held in bondage to another; one who is wholly subject to the will of another; one who is held as a chattel; one who has no freedom of action, but whose person and services are wholly under the control of another.
- noun. One who has lost the power of resistance; one who surrenders himself to any power whatever; as, a slave to passion, to lust, to strong drink, to ambition.
- noun. A drudge; one who labors like a slave.
- noun. An abject person; a wretch.
- intransitive verb. To drudge; to toil; to labor as a slave.
- transitive verb. To enslave.
- noun. a person who is owned by someone
- noun. someone who works as hard as a slave
- noun. someone entirely dominated by some influence or person
"a slave to fashion"
"a slave to cocaine"
- verb. work very hard, like a slave
